1. 概述
1.1 版本
FineBI 版本 |
---|
5.1.15 |
1.2 更新说明
2021-08-05 日,帆软发布了 5.1.15 版本 FineBI,本文将简单介绍此次更新的重点。
如何升级至 5.1.15 版本请参见:5.1.5后的版本升级指南
1.3 升级兼容说明
使用直连集群的用户需要在 nginx.conf 中直连请求对应的 BI.cluster.com 中加一条 hash "$cookie_fine_login_users - $http_sessionid"; 保存后重启 nginx 生效。
4040页面会默认关闭,如果客户有需求需要手动添加参数开启,详细请参见:FineBI端口开放列表 。
由于功能重构,升级后首次启动会比较慢,时间长短根据用户的自助数据集的数量而不同。
原来只可以授权使用和授权权限的次管升级后可以分配使用、管理和授权权限;同时,原来只可以授权部分列的次管升级后可以分配所有列权限。
1.4 简述
数据准备
1. 优化:公式输入框中输入部分字母或部分文字,会自动搜索出相应的字段或函数供用户选择 详情
2. 新增:为未安装 websocket 的用户提供数据集的手动刷新功能 详情
3. 新增:自助数据集新增汇总值功能 详情
4. 优化:增加自助数据集不能选自己子表的交互提示 详情
5. 新增:有自助数据集使用权限的用户可以查看到该自助数据集的制作步骤 详情
6. 优化:去除老版本中自助数据集的抽取设置 详情
7. 优化:更换 Oracle 数据库的内置驱动版本 详情
8. 优化:不同业务包下的数据表允许重名 详情
仪表板
1. 新增:支持直接复制公式到输入框进行复用 详情
2. 优化:为保证性能,明细表超过 50 列的情况下,分页行数不能超过 100 行 明细表
3. 新增:支持一键清空已拖入分析区域的字段 详情
4. 新增:图表值轴的显示范围支持「按各维度动态计算」详情
5. 优化:范围面积图的默认堆积方式优化 详情
6. 优化:优化对比柱形图的轴逆序设置 详情
平台
1. 优化:普通权限设置和授权权限设置分开,互不影响 详情
2. 新增:增加「Token 认证增强 」按钮,服务器增加 IP 校验 详情
3. 优化:在平台日志中可以筛选到用户名为空,模板名为空的数据 详情
4. 新增:自定义登录页可以预览效果 详情
5. 优化:将系统日志和操作日志分割操作 详情
6. 优化:选择不安全的协议时, FineBI 会给出风险提示 详情
7. 优化:用户 LDAP 认证新增「测试连接」按钮方便用户测试 详情
8. 优化:在安全防护页面增加防护信息的详细说明 详情
9. 新增:增加同步用户异常时的熔断设置 详情
10. 优化:配置外界数据库的模式时可在系统选择,不需要再手动填写 详情
11. 优化:新增表保存报错时,也支持导出报错日志 详情
12. 优化:新增防刷屏机制,防日志重复打印 详情
13. 优化:做资源迁移,版本不一致时,系统会弹出提示 详情
14. 新增:FineBI 与 FineReport连接工具插件支持主从服务器都有fitler单点登录 详情
15. 优化:优化外接数据库权限相关 详情
16. 新增:新增 BI 工具,用于定位分析问题,提供部分快捷查询入口和自动分析功能 详情
2. 数据准备
2.1 公式输入框自动搜索字段或函数
在公式输入框,用户可以通过输入首字母或首个字搜索字段或函数。如下图所示:
详情请参见:新增列-公式函数
2.2 新增数据集手动刷新功能
未安装 websocket 的用户无法自动获取最新数据和新创建的自助数据集,需要手动刷新。如下图所示:
详情请参见:创建自助数据集
2.3 新增支持汇总值
在新增列中,支持用户在不影响原有字段基础上,进行一些汇总计算。如下图所示:
详情请参见:新增列-汇总值
2.4 优化不能选自己子表的交互提示
自助数据集不能在「选字段、左右合并、上下合并」步骤中,选择自己的子表,如下图所示:
详情请参见:上下合并
2.5 新增使用权限的用户可查看自助数据集步骤
支持只能使用但不能编辑自助数据集的用户查看到自助数据集内部的步骤,方便他们理解自助数据集的数据,减少沟通成本。让用户在自助数据集查看步骤、制作新数据集可以更灵活,效率更高。
详情请参见:查看自助数据集步骤
2.6 去除自助数据集的抽取设置
5.1.15 及之后的版本,将对除最简自助数据集外的所有自助数据集默认强抽取。如下图所示:
详情请参见:更新信息
2.7 更换 Oracle 的内置驱动版本
详情请参见:Oracle 数据连接
2.8 不同业务包下面的数据表允许重名
详情请参见:数据表存放管理概述
3. 仪表板
3.1 支持直接复制公式
支持使用 CTRL+C 和 CTRL+V 直接复制公式,如下图所示:
详情请参见:函数计算格式
3.2 明细表分页行数优化
为保证性能最优,5.1.15 版本当表格大于等于 50 列后,明细表均不能支持设置「分页行数」超过 100 行。如下图所示:
3.3 新增一键清空字段
支持用户在组件编辑界面一键清除字段,如下图所示:
详情请参见:一键清空组件字段
3.4 支持按各维度动态计算
轴刻度支持按维度动态计算,如下图所示:
功能说明:若勾选「按各维度动态计算」,每个维度分区值轴范围根据实际值显示,保证图形的趋势变化可以较为明显的查看
生效条件:纵轴拖入维度字段情况下,对纵轴上的指标字段生效;若不满足该条件,即使勾选「按各维度动态计算」,该功能也不生效
详情请参见:图表设置轴
3.5 范围面积图默认堆积方式优化
详情请参见:范围面积图
3.6 优化对比柱形图的轴逆序设置
详情请参见:对比柱形图
4. 平台
4.1 拆分普通权限设置和授权权限设置
普通权限与授权权限解耦,互不影响。如下图所示:
详情请参见:权限
4.2 新增 Token 认证增强 按钮
Token对应的状态服务器中的登录信息会存储IP。开启「Token认证增强」按钮后,服务器增加IP校验:
IP相同则自动放行。
IP不同则识别为新的客户端,自动跳转到登录页,需要重新登录。
详情请参见:安全防护
4.3 平台日志中可筛选模板名为空的数据
在平台日志中,「模板访问明细」支持筛选操作用户/模板名称为空的日志,「用户行为」支持筛选操作用户为空的日志,「模板热度」支持筛选模板名称为空的模板。
详情请参见:平台日志
4.4 自定义登录页可以预览效果
用户可在自定义登录页直接预览自定义的效果,如下图所示:
详情请参见:自定义登录界面
4.5 分割系统日志和操作日志
将系统日志和操作日志分割成两部分,方便用户理解这两部分日志的区别。如下图所示:
详细请参见:日志简介
4.6 优化选择不安全协议时的提示
FineBI 在用户选择不安全的协议时,会给出相应的提示。如下图所示:
详情请参见:邮箱
4.7 LDAP 认证新增「测试连接」按钮
在用户管理中使用 LDAP 认证时, FineBI 新提供「测试连接」按钮,方便用户在设置页就可以知晓是否连接成功。如下图所示:
详情请参见:LDAP认证
4.8 增加防护信息的详细说明
在安全防护页面增加了防护功能的详细说明文档,帮助用户了解安全防护功能。如下图所示:
详情请参见:安全防护
4.9 增加同步用户异常时的熔断设置
用户可设置同步用户异常时,自动熔断的功能,避免错误的用户信息导入到 FineBI 中。如下图所示:
详情请参见:同步用户
4.10 优化数据库模式输入方式
配置外接数据库时,5.1.15 版本支持直接在系统中选择数据库对应的模式,不再需要用户手动输入模式。
详情请参见:配置Oracle外接数据库
4.11 新增表保存报错,支持导出报错日志
详情请参见:错误代码汇总
4.12 新增日志防刷屏机制
防止同一条报错信息重复刷屏。
详细请参见:日志简介
4.13 资源迁移提示版本必须一致
当用户想在不同版本的 FineBI 之间实现资源迁移时, FineBI 会弹出提示,如下图所示:
详情请参见:资源迁移目录
4.14 支持主从服务器都有fitler单点登录
FineBI 与 FineReport连接工具插件支持主从服务器都有fitler单点登录。
详情请参见: FineBI 与FineReport 连接工具插件
4.15 优化外接数据库数据权限相关
外接数据库数据更改后,外接数据库用户若没有相关权限,例如:create、alter,工程启动后会进入部署向导页面,给出提示.如下图所示:
详情请参见:服务器部署向导
4.16 新增 BI 工具
一般用于定位分析问题,提供部分快捷查询入口和自动分析功能。如下图所示:
详情请参见:BI 工具简介